What happens when mongo seed is planted in sandy soil?

When mongo seed is planted in sandy soil, it can easily establish root systems due to the loose texture of the soil. However, sandy soil tends to drain quickly and may not retain enough moisture for optimal growth. To address this, it is important to provide frequent irrigation and incorporate organic matter into the sandy soil to improve water retention and nutrient availability for the mongo plant.

What are the objectives of mongo seeds?

The objectives of growing mongo seeds, also known as mung beans, include producing a nutritious and versatile food source rich in protein, fiber, and essential nutrients. Additionally, growing mongo seeds can be used for agricultural purposes, such as cover cropping to improve soil fertility and prevent erosion. The seeds can also be sprouted for culinary use in salads, stir-fries, and other dishes, adding a crunchy texture and fresh flavor. Overall, the objectives of mongo seed cultivation are to promote food security, sustainable agriculture, and healthy eating habits.

What happened to the mongo seeds?

When mongo seeds, also called mung beans, germinate, they become bean sprouts, which are edible. Various parts of the mung plant are used in South Asian and East Asian cuisine.

Where will mongo seed grow best?

Mongo seeds will grow best in well-draining soil that is rich in organic matter. They prefer a sunny location and warm temperatures for optimal growth. It is also important to provide consistent moisture to the plants during their growing season.
